Strengthening Zambia’s Capital Market through Dialogue, Compliance & Sustainable Innovation

At the Securities and Exchange Commission Zambia (SEC), we are committed to fostering a robust, transparent, and inclusive capital market. Through our recent stakeholder engagements including the AML/CFT Compliance Workshop (2024) and the Annual Capital Markets Operators (CMO) Workshop (2025). We continue to prioritize education, regulatory alignment, and market development.

In 2024, the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) convened Capital Market Operators (CMOs) to address critical risks related to Anti-Money Laundering and Countering the Financing of Terrorism (AML/CFT). The workshop emphasized the importance of regulatory compliance, timely reporting of suspicious transactions, and ethical conduct among market participants. This was done in collaboration with the Financial Intelligence Centre (FIC) and law enforcement agencies, the SEC reaffirmed its commitment to safeguarding market integrity.

In 2025, our Annual CMO Workshop themed “Building Resilience Through Sustainable Growth” spotlighted Zambia’s progress, challenges, and bold steps toward capital market reform. With over 100 industry stakeholders in attendance, the event reviewed performance metrics, regulatory milestones like Shareholder Vetting Guidelines, and ongoing efforts under the Capital Markets Master Plan (CMMP). Dialogue on sustainable finance, climate risks, and the integration of informal financial systems emphasized our inclusive approach to development.

Our commitment remains steadfast: empowering market operators, enhancing investor protection, and championing Zambia’s role in regional and global capital markets.
